    • Effects of Onion Residue, Bovine Manure Compost and Compost Tea on Soils and on the Agroecological Production of Onions 

      Orden, Luciano; Ferreiro, Nicolás; Satti, Patricia; Navas-Gracia, Luis Manuel; Chico-Santamarta, Leticia; Rodríguez, Roberto A. (MDPI, 2021-10)
      Organic solid wastes are rarely considered when planning for rural production in Argentina. Onion production in the low valley of Río Colorado (Buenos Aires) generates between 12,000 and 20,000 Mg year−1 of vegetal wastes ...
